The Evolution and Mechanics of CSGO Casinos: A Comprehensive Guide
Counter-Strike: Global Offensive (CSGO)-- and its successor Counter-Strike 2 (CS2)-- is more than just a famous tactical shooter; it birthed a massive, multi-million-dollar virtual economy focused around weapon finishes, commonly known as "skins." As these digital products gained real-world monetary value, an entirely parallel industry emerged: CSGO casinos.

For the inexperienced, navigating the world of skin gambling can be complicated and frustrating. This guide explores what CSGO casinos are, how they operate, the most popular games available, and the intrinsic dangers included.
What is a CSGO Casino?
A CSGO casino is a specific online gambling platform where players use virtual weapon skins instead of traditional fiat currency (like GBP or EUR) to place bets. For the most part, gamers transfer their skins into the platform's bot inventory, which credits their account with a comparable site balance (typically represented in coins or credits).
Once funded, gamers can utilize these credits to play different casino-style games. If they win, they can withdraw higher-value skins back to their Steam inventories, which they can either keep or offer on third-party marketplaces genuine cash.
The Mechanics: How Skin Gambling Works
The environment relies heavily on the Steam Web API and peer-to-peer (P2P) trading systems. Comprehending the lifecycle of a skin deposit and withdrawal clarifies how these platforms function:
- Account Linking: Users log into the gambling establishment site using their Steam qualifications through OpenID.
- Deposit: The gamer chooses unwanted skins from their Steam stock. A safe bot trade deal is started, moving the products to the casino.
- Credit Conversion: The platform values the skins (usually based on typical Steam Market or third-party rates indices) and credits the user's account.
- Wagering: Players utilize their balance to play video games.
- Withdrawal: Successful gamers browse the casino's marketplace or bot inventory and request a trade deal for new skins of equivalent value.
Popular Games Found on CSGO Casinos
Unlike standard online gambling establishments that feature hundreds of fruit machine, CSGO casinos frequently mix classic gambling establishment titles with video games distinctively tailored to the video gaming community.
Game Type Description Home Edge Crash A multiplier increases from 1.00 x upward. Gamers should "cash out" before the multiplier arbitrarily crashes. If it crashes before squandering, the bet is lost. Typically 1%-- 3% Roulette A wheel divided into colored sectors (usually Red, Black, and Green/Zero). Players wager on which color the wheel will arrive on. Normally 2%-- 5% Coinflip A 1v1 PvP video game where 2 gamers wager skins of equal value. A virtual coin flip decides the winner of the whole pot. Normally takes a 5% commission (rake) Case Opening Replicates the video game's official case opening system, but typically with much better marketed chances or customized community-made cases. Variable (Usually higher than standard video games) Jackpot Several players contribute skins to a central pot. Why has the CSGO gambling market sustained itself for nearly a decade? A number of aspects contribute to its long-lasting popularity:
- Accessibility: For more youthful demographics or gamers who can not quickly access traditional online gambling sites due to age limitations or regional laws, skin gambling uses an alternative entry point.
- The Thrill of the "Unbox": Valve's official case opening system is notorious for low odds. Lots of third-party sites market themselves as having better chances or more satisfying formats.
- Community Culture: Content developers, banners, and esports influencers regularly sponsor or showcase these sites, normalizing the activity for millions of audiences.
- Pseudonymity and Speed: Transactions including digital possessions can occur in seconds, bypassing traditional banking confirmation delays.
Risks and Regulatory Challenges
While the principle of playing games with virtual items sounds harmless, the CSGO gambling establishment environment operates in a complex legal and ethical gray location. Players and observers ought to note a number of significant threats:
- Lack of Regulation: Unlike licensed conventional casinos, many CSGO gambling sites operate offshore with little to no regulative oversight. This indicates if a site abruptly shuts down, users have essentially no legal option to recover their funds.
- Fairness and Transparency: While lots of sites utilize "Provably Fair" algorithms-- allowing users to cryptographically verify that game outcomes are not controlled-- deceitful platforms can and do rig games.
- Valve's Crackdowns: Valve (the developer of Counter-Strike) highly opposes business gambling utilizing its API. Over the years, Valve has enacted sweeping updates, trade holds, and mass-banning waves targeting numerous gambling bot accounts to curb the practice.
- Danger of Addiction: Because skins are considered as virtual pixels rather than hard-earned cash, users typically show riskier monetary behaviors, possibly causing considerable monetary loss when skins are liquidated for genuine currency.
Essential Safety Tips for Users
For those who choose to explore CSGO casinos, care and digital health are critical. Observing finest practices can alleviate typical security threats:
- Beware of Phishing: Always navigate to gambling sites straight instead of clicking links from random social networks profiles, chat messages, or sponsored streams. Deceitful clone sites are rampant.
- Protect Your Steam API Key: Never log into unknown third-party extensions or enter your Steam API key into unfamiliar browser prompts. Scammers utilize this to obstruct trade offers.
- Set Strict Budgets: Only play with skins you are entirely comfy losing. Deal with skin gambling simply as home entertainment, never ever as a dependable source of income.
- Enable Two-Factor Authentication: Ensure your Steam Guard Mobile Authenticator is active to safeguard your inventory from unauthorized access.
